    PoM on cooldown isn't necessarily right. If it still has 4 stacks on someone, then don't throw out another. Especially when you get 2pc. Watching your PoM is more important than throwing it on CD.

    Cascade isn't always the best, try using Divine Star on fights where you can hit a handful of people or you're stacked. It's generally higher HPS and easier on mana.

    Renew on tanks is great when you have mana, but honestly isn't going to make or break your tanks staying alive, you can cut some mana here. Also, especially if you're using Renew glyph, as you're casting it way too often to keep it up, and this is a pretty large mana drain.

    DI is not a "free proc" you still spend mana on it. Use this one anyone with damage taken, or someone that is near other people.

    Reforge all crit to mastery.

    Quote Originally Posted by rmlunsford View Post
    Cool yeah I'm just trying to understand this one, really nothing comparable as a resto shaman. So basically I should aim to let it stay out there until it runs out of stacks. When would be a good time to "clip" it?
    You shouldn't really be trying to clip PoM (it is not a hot/dot). If there is constant raid damage going out you should wait for the charges of your previous pom to run out and then reapply to a low health target which will be taking damage. It's not about putting PoM out as much as possible, it is about understanding when PoM is the right spell to cast. If you're PoM is regularly expiring at multiple charges remaining you may want to evaluate what situations you're choosing to cast it and if you're choosing an optimal target. Some common damage patterns for PoM include bouncing it between tanks, ticking raid aoe damage, bouncing between debuffed raid members (think frostbite on council), etc.

    One thing I found helpful was to get up to the 4721 Haste breakpoint. You can probably do it with your gear ... so Spirit -> 4721 Haste -> Mastery -> Crit.

    You should look it up, but there are certain ranges of haste at which the renew glyph is actually worse than unglyphed.

    If you're having mana issues, replace glyph of CoH as well. 35% mana cost for 20% increased throughput (assuming there are in fact 6 injured targets).
